大鼠心肌成纤维细胞是肾上腺髓质素的重要来源

Myocardial fibroblasts of rat are an important source of producing adrenomedullin

【摘要】 目的 :本实验在培养的大鼠心肌成纤维细胞 (Fb)和心肌细胞上观察了肾上腺髓质素 (AM)分泌和 5种因素对AM合成和分泌的调节 ,以阐明心肌组织AM的细胞来源。方法 :乳鼠心肌Fb和心肌细胞培养 ;放射免疫法测定AM的含量 ;放射配基结合法测定Fb和心肌细胞AM受体。结果 :心肌Fb和心肌细胞均可合成和分泌AM ,而且成纤维细胞分泌AM远高于心肌细胞 (P <0 .0 1)。肿瘤坏死因子α(tumornecrosisfactor,TNFα)、脂多糖 (lipopolysaccharide ,LPS)和碱性成纤维细胞生长因子 (bFGF)可刺激Fb和心肌细胞AM的合成与分泌。转移生长因子 β (transformationgrowthfactorβ ,TGFβ)和干扰素α(interferoneα ,IFNα)可抑制Fb和心肌细胞合成分泌AM。成纤维细胞存在着高亲和力和低亲和力两种结合位点 ,而心肌细胞仅存在着高亲和结合位点 ,心肌细胞AM受体Bmax值高于Fb (P <0 0 1)。结论 :心肌Fb也合成和分泌AM ,Fb和心肌细胞都存在AM受体。

【Abstract】 AIM: To elucidate the cellular source of adrenomedullin (AM) in myocardial tissue, the effects of 5 substances on secretion of AM from cultured rat fibroblasts and myocytes were examined in this study. METHODS: Myocardial fibroblast and myocyte isolation and culture; AM was measured by radioimmunoassay; AM receptors were assayed by radioactive analysis method. RESULTS:Tumor necrosis factor α (TNFα), lipopolysaccharide (LPS) and basic fibroblast growth factor (bFGF) all could stimulate AM synthesis and secretion in myocardial Fb and myocyte , and the amount of AM secreted by Fb was greater than that by myocytes, whereas transforming growth factor-β(TGFβ),and interferon-α(IFNα) suppressed in it in myocardial Fb and myocytes. Myocardial Fb has two kinds of AM binding sites, but myocyte has only one high affinity- binding site.CONCLUSIOIN:Myocardial fibroblasts could synthesize and secrete AM, and there are AM receptors in both myocardial fibroblasts and myocytes.
